1. Ultra-Processed Foods: Insulin Spikes and Anger
Most “convenience” meals—packaged snacks, instant noodles, and frozen dinners—are laden with refined sugar, refined carbs, and unhealthy fats. When you eat these, your blood sugar plummets and surges, triggering mood swings, irritability, and cravings. This rollercoaster strains cortisol, the stress hormone, amplifying stress and impatience throughout the day.

4. High-Fructose Corn Syrup in “Healthy” Swaps: Yo-Yo Energy and Mood Swings
Found in “natural” cereals, flavored yogurts, and sauces, high-fructose corn syrup delivers rapid energy spikes followed by crashes. This rollercoaster fuels irritability, anxiety, and difficulty concentrating—especially in children and adults alike.
5. Trans Fats in Fried and Processed Foods: Damage to Brain Inflammation
Partially hydrogenated oils lurk in many pre-cooked and fast meals. Trans fats inflame the brain, impair neuronal signaling, and contribute to depression, irritability, and overall emotional dysregulation.
What to Eat Instead: Foods That Calm and Fuel
Switching from brain-draining meals to mood-stabilizing foods can dramatically improve how you feel. Consider:
- Omega-3 rich fish (salmon, sardines) to reduce inflammation
- Complex whole grains (quinoa, oats) for steady energy
- Fermented foods (kimchi, sauerkraut) to support gut-brain axis health
- Magnesium-packed leafy greens & nuts to lower stress reactivity
- Balanced proteins (chicken, legumes) to sustain satiety and calm nerves
